Type Confusion in Google Chromium - CVE-2024-2887

 

Type Confusion in Google Chromium - CVE-2024-2887

Published: March 26, 2024 / Updated: August 30, 2024


Vulnerability identifier: #VU87838
CSH Severity: High
CVSS v4: 8.6 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N]
CVE-ID: CVE-2024-2887
CWE-ID: CWE-843
Exploitation vector: Remote access
Exploit availability: Public exploit is available

Vulnerability details

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to a type confusion error within the WebAssembly component in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it, trigger a type confusion error and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.

How to mitigate CVE-2024-2887

Install update from vendor's website.

Google Chromium - update to 123.0.6312.86
Kibana - addressed in versions 7.17.22, 8.14.0
Microsoft Edge - addressed in versions 122.0.2365.113, 123.0.2420.65
Google Chrome - update to 123.0.6312.86
www-client/opera - update to 73.0.3856.284
www-client/microsoft-edge - update to 110.0.5130.35
chromium - addressed in versions 123.0.6312.86-1.fc38, 123.0.6312.86-1.fc39, 123.0.6312.86-1.fc40, 123.0.6312.105-1.el7, 123.0.6312.105-1.el8, 123.0.6312.105-1.el9
chromium (Debian package) - update to 123.0.6312.86-1~deb12u1
www-client/google-chrome - update to 124.0.2478.97
ww-client/microsoft-edge - update to 124.0.6367.155
www-client/chromium - update to 124.0.6367.155
